You will be in for a berry, berry, blueberry good time this coming weekend, August 15-17 in Machias for the Annual Machias Wild Blueberry Festival.

You won't want to miss the the original 2025 Machias Wild Blueberry Festival Musical Comedy, with the Pringle Family Re-enactors as they give you outlandish takes on imagined moments that could have happened. It's a time-traveling musical comedy that berry funny and historically sketchy! It will be performed on August 14-16 at 7 p.m. at the Centre Street Congregational Church.
